Yep! I just responded to one recently. And what we did was rent a car through Enterprise at their downtown location and then returned it the morning of our cruise. They have a shuttle to take you & your luggage to the pier! It was super easy!!

Alamo, Enterprise and National have the Port contracts, but it wouldn't hurt to check around for the best price with all the rental agencies. Or maybe you have points to use? Pier 91 is only a 10 minute ride from downtown, so $20/$25 by cab. If you find a good deal the cab fare might be worth it.....
